Are Pringles potato chips or crisps?

Asked 6 months ago
Pringles are not officially classified as potato chips or crisps. Instead, they fall under the category of "potato-based snacks." While the general perception is that Pringles are potato chips, their unique shape and texture set them apart. Unlike traditional potato chips, Pringles are made from dehydrated processed potatoes that are then formed into their distinctive curved shape. Additionally, they undergo a different cooking process compared to regular chips. Pringles are cooked and stacked in specialized ovens, ensuring their uniform shape and texture. Therefore, while Pringles share some characteristics with potato chips, their composition and manufacturing process make them a distinct category of potato-based snacks.
